Okay, enough ranting. The Devil and Miss Jones. Was a comedy with a social message, but not too serious, light and very funny, and had nothing whatever to do with porn. The Devil is Charles Coburn, a billionaire businessman who goes undercover as a lowly clerk in one of his holdings, a department store which is reportedly going union. Miss Jones is Jean Arthur, a salesgirl in the shoe department who takes Coburn under her wing and teaches him about life and kindness to your fellow man and blah blah.
The movie has a fairly leftist message: the union organizers are brave and noble champions of the downtrodden, while the store management, the bigshot lawyers, and Coburn (before his epiphany) are greedy, petty, nasty people. So it surprised me to learn that the director, Sam Wood, later provided key testimony to HUAC. But then again those were the days of the studio system so maybe he didn't have a choice about doing this movie.
